Day 02: Exploring Kathmandu
Begin your morning with a visit to the revered Pashupatinath Temple, one of the most sacred sites among Hindu temples. Nestled along the banks of the Bagmati River, this stunning two-tiered golden temple, adorned with four intricately designed silver doorways, exemplifies the unique artistry of Nepalese temple architecture. As one of the largest Hindu temple complexes in South Asia, it houses countless Shiva lingams and various shrines dedicated to Hindu deities.
Next, we will journey to Bouddhanath, the most significant Buddhist site in Nepal. This ancient and monumental stupa, towering at approximately 36 meters, is one of the largest of its kind in the country. It is set upon an expansive three-tiered mandala platform, encircled by vibrant family homes.
In the afternoon, we will continue our exploration with a visit to Kathmandu Durbar Square and Swayambhunath. The Kathmandu Durbar Square, known locally as Hanuman Dhoka Palace Square, lies at the city’s core and was once the royal seat of Nepalese royalty. The Hanuman Dhoka Palace complex features a grand royal square filled with a remarkable array of temples dedicated to various Hindu gods and goddesses, with most structures dating back to the 15th to 18th centuries. Our next stop is Swayambhunath, perched on a charming hillock. This magnificent stupa, believed to have been constructed around 250 B.C., offers breathtaking views of the Kathmandu Valley and the stunning panorama of the northeastern Himalayan range. Day 03: Kathmandu to Nagarkot (32 km, approximately 1.5 hours drive)
Today, we embark on a scenic drive to Nagarkot, a renowned tourist haven in Nepal. Nestled 32 kilometers to the east of Kathmandu, this charming destination sits at an elevation of 2,175 meters above sea level. From Nagarkot, one can marvel at the breathtaking vistas of the prominent peaks of the eastern Nepal Himalaya, including the majestic Sagarmatha (Mount Everest).
